Abstract
Nanocellulose (NC) isolation from different types of agroindustrial wastes is emerging as ital. Field of research, because of its multifunctional applications. This work uses the VOS viewer software for extracting the agroindustry based nanocellulose production. This review specifically grasps the attention of scientists towards on valorization of agricultural wastes as sources for nanocellulose production. It also explores the variety of sources including vegetables, fruits, cereals and nuts. The ecological system is negatively influenced by the chemicals and its derived products; these products have caused the ecological imbalance. The demand for functional materials and fine chemicals made from natural resources is enormous. NC is considered as one of the promising green material and next generation renewable resource. Further, this work describes about the pre-treatment, characterization and synthesis of nanocellulose from agro-industrial waste using mechanical, chemical and enzymatic methods. It also elaborate the management of agricultural wastes for the purpose of reducing environmental impact, use of fossil based fuel resources, assuring the sustainable economic growth and close the circle of green economy and its resource use. In addition, the potential and versatile applications of nanocellulose from diverse industrial and agricultural sources were discussed.
